I am learning e-guide on the demand version of e-guide 7.11. I understand that all the processing of data occurs on SAS servers but the software becomes unresponsive quite often for minutes when i click on different tabs or tasks for e.g. even after processing has taken place.
It is making learning E-guide a very slow and frustrating process.
Has anyone faced such problems? Any solutions?
Check for the network latencies to the on-demand server. EG access to the server often seems to happen in many small requests, so a 500ms ping delay can quickly sum up to noticable delays when, say, a hundred individual requests need to be handled.
I often experience noticable delays in opening results when the server is under load (EG 4.3).
Keep in mind that opening a task may also include access to the dataset that EG thinks will be the input for the task.
